vc++编程问题,设计登录系统
如何让读者和管理员成功登录后,有不同的界面使用?设计时以什么为主体,对话框,单文档还是多文档?...
如何让读者和管理员成功登录后,有不同的界面使用?设计时以什么为主体,对话框,单文档还是多文档?
展开
2个回答
展开全部
楼主好~解决的办法有很多
1、同一窗体的话可以用不同的窗口panel存放不同对象使用的控件界面,通过对登录的是读者还是管理员进行判断再确定要显示的是哪个容器即可;
2、同理,只是改成两个窗体,对不同的登录对象显示不同的窗体;
3、如果仅仅只是类似上图一样部分控件内容更改,如文本“用户名”改为“管理员”的话,那直接控件的属性更改了就可以了。
一般类似的设计我喜欢以工作和操作的窗体为主窗体,由于登录的窗体基本只用一两次,所以不把他设为主窗体,否则之后你只能一直隐藏登录的窗体。同时如果一旦不小心关闭了登录的窗体,那以此窗体为父窗体的打开的全部子窗体都会被关闭。
以上为个人喜好,不算是标准~楼主个人看愿意。
1、同一窗体的话可以用不同的窗口panel存放不同对象使用的控件界面,通过对登录的是读者还是管理员进行判断再确定要显示的是哪个容器即可;
2、同理,只是改成两个窗体,对不同的登录对象显示不同的窗体;
3、如果仅仅只是类似上图一样部分控件内容更改,如文本“用户名”改为“管理员”的话,那直接控件的属性更改了就可以了。
一般类似的设计我喜欢以工作和操作的窗体为主窗体,由于登录的窗体基本只用一两次,所以不把他设为主窗体,否则之后你只能一直隐藏登录的窗体。同时如果一旦不小心关闭了登录的窗体,那以此窗体为父窗体的打开的全部子窗体都会被关闭。
以上为个人喜好,不算是标准~楼主个人看愿意。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询